    Another study, Song Recognition among Preschool-Age Children: An Investigation of Words and Music investigated relationships between words and pitch and melody recognition. The study found that preschool children more accurately recognized songs performed without texts when they had heard them performed previously with texts.

    The Children's and Family Emmy Award for Outstanding Voice Performer in a Preschool Animated Program honors performances in both television series and made-for-television/streaming films. The category was established at the 1st Children's and Family Emmy Awards in 2022, and is open to lead, supporting and guest performers of all genders.
